Française des Jeux Achieves Significant Efficiency Gains with UiPath’s AI-Powered Automation
UiPath, a leading agentic automation and AI software company, today announced that La Française des Jeux (FDJ), France’s top gaming operator, has successfully implemented the UiPath Platform to revolutionize key business processes through three innovative projects. This transformative initiative has also earned FDJ recognition as a winner of the UiPath AI25 Awards, celebrating the most innovative uses of AI and automation.
FDJ is the leading French gambling and lottery operator, serving over 25 million players through nearly 30,000 points of sale across 11,000 municipalities. With annual stakes of €20.6 billion, including €2.5 billion in digital stakes, FDJ generates €2.5 billion in revenue and contributes €4.1 billion in public levies on gambling. The company employs nearly 2,700 people and sustains over 55,300 jobs throughout France.
Key highlights of FDJ’s AI and automation implementation with UiPath:
-
ACPR (Autorité de Contrôle Prudentiel et de Résolution) Project: Automated retailer registration process using UiPath Document Understanding saves 250 working days annually, accelerating revenue generation across FDJ’s extensive retail network
-
NIV (Nouvelle Identité Visuelle or New Visual Identity) Project: AI-powered image analysis will ensure 100% verification of new visual identity across 30,000 retail locations, maintaining brand consistency once implemented
-
Mails Fournisseurs Project: AI-driven email management system, leveraging UiPath AI Center, which processes 10,000 supplier emails annually, will significantly reduce manual workload for FDJ’s finance team

The ACPR project, a partnership with the Directorate General of Public Finances (DGFiP), automated the registration process for 30,000 retailers offering a new payment service. UiPath Document Understanding extracts and verifies retailer information, saving 20 minutes per retailer and processing 6,000 retailers annually. This streamlined process allows retailers to offer FDJ new products sooner, directly impacting revenue.
In the NIV project, AI-powered image analysis shifted quality control from sample-based to 100% verification of FDJ’s new visual identity installation across its retail network. This comprehensive approach ensures accuracy and completeness in brand representation, critical for a company with FDJ’s extensive retail presence.
The Mails Fournisseurs project employs multiple AI models, including UiPath AI Center for natural language processing, to manage supplier emails. The system automates classification, data extraction, and response generation for invoices and payment status queries. While responses are currently validated by the accounting team, the goal is full automation, promising significant time and resource savings for FDJ’s finance operations.

Golden Nugget Atlantic City Announces Re-opening of Sportsbook with New, Innovative Technology and Expanded Betting Markets
Golden Nugget Atlantic City has announced the re-opening of its Sportsbook on January 29, 2025. Relaunching just in time for the Super Bowl, the revamped Sportsbook introduces state-of-the-art technology with many new features, delivering a premier betting experience for customers to enjoy.
“Perfectly timed for guests to get their bets in for the Super Bowl, we are launching new and improved technology and betting options. Our team is committed to providing an elevated betting atmosphere, and these enhancements are proof of that,” said General Manager Tom Pohlman.
The upgraded Sportsbook will offer an array of new betting capabilities including UFC/MMA, college baseball, college softball, women’s college basketball, men’s college hockey and the Summer and Winter Olympics. Other features include same game parlays, teasers with both traditional or alternate spreads, a wider range of player and team props options, boosted odds, a bet builder to create personalized bets, and the allowance of an early cashout.
Conveniently located off the Main Atrium, the Sportsbook boasts over 50 TVs, five video walls, and numerous self-betting kiosks, making it the perfect spot to watch your favourite event. Beyond betting, guests can also enjoy all your favoirite game day eats and drinks.
Regular hours of operation are Monday through Friday from 3 p.m. to 11 p.m., Saturday from 11 a.m. to 11 p.m., and Sunday from 10 a.m. to 11 p.m. Customers are also able to place bets 24/7 on kiosks throughout the casino floor.

Aristocrat Gaming Begins Expanded Launch of NFL-Themed Slot Machine Franchise with 13-Casino Event in Puerto Rico
Following the historic North American launch of the NFL-themed portfolio, Aristocrat Gaming has now begun to launch its player-favorite NFL Slots franchise outside of the continental U.S. with a 13-casino debut on the Jackpot del Encanto link in Puerto Rico.
The all-new NFL Triple Score by Aristocrat Gaming will be the first title in the NFL Slots franchise to launch beyond the US, and the company marked the industry game-changing event with a ribbon cutting ceremony and celebration on January 22 at Casino del Mar in San Juan, Puerto Rico.
NFL Triple Score is now available on gaming floors alongside Jackpot del Encanto, a program featuring select slot machines in participating casinos across the Island. In this program, prizes increase as more players participate, with a progressive jackpot starting at $20,000. The game is showcased on the MarsX Portrait cabinet and is modeled after the wildly successful Bao Zhu Zhao Fu game family. It incorporates the best features of other NFL-themed games, including the “pick your team, play your team” customization option, complete with 32-team graphics, symbols, and NFL game footage.

NIP Group Partners with Abu Dhabi Investment Office to Accelerate Abu Dhabi’s Esports Industry
NIP Group Inc., a leading digital entertainment company, announced that it has entered a multi-year partnership with the Abu Dhabi Investment Office (ADIO) to drive gaming, media and entertainment growth in Abu Dhabi.
The five-year landmark agreement will see ADIO support NIP Group’s expansion in the region. Under the agreement, ADIO will support the Company with access to financial and non-financial growth opportunities valued at up to US$40 million over a four-year period. The NIP Group will establish its global headquarters in Abu Dhabi and will contribute to local employment in the esports and gaming sector. The Company will also increase its capacity across key business verticals in the region, including esports operations, creative studios and game publishing, alongside events and talent management.
Through the partnership, NIP Group will work directly with ADIO to advise on its gaming and esports strategy, leveraging Abu Dhabi’s location and resources to build a thriving local gaming ecosystem and deliver innovative digital entertainment solutions worldwide.
